What is a project engineer naval architect?

A Project Engineer Naval Architect is a professional who combines engineering skills with specialized knowledge of ship design and construction. They are responsible for planning, designing, and overseeing the construction, maintenance, and repair of ships, boats, and other marine vessels. Their role often involves collaborating with multidisciplinary teams, ensuring compliance with safety and regulatory standards, and managing project timelines and budgets. Project Engineer Naval Architects play a vital role in both commercial and military marine projects, contributing to the development of innovative and efficient vessels.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a project engineer naval architect?

To thrive as a Project Engineer Naval Architect, you need a strong background in naval architecture, marine engineering, and project management, usually supported by a relevant engineering degree and professional accreditation. Proficiency with CAD software, finite element analysis tools, and project management systems like MS Project or Primavera is typically required. Excellent problem-solving abilities, teamwork, and effective communication help drive project success and stakeholder collaboration. These skills ensure safe, efficient, and innovative vessel design and construction within deadline and budget constraints.

What is the difference between Project Engineer Naval Architect vs Marine Engineer?

AspectProject Engineer Naval ArchitectMarine Engineer
CredentialsBachelor's in Naval Architecture or Marine Engineering, Professional Engineer (PE) license often preferredBachelor's in Marine Engineering, Mechanical Engineering, or related field; PE license advantageous
Work EnvironmentDesign offices, shipyards, construction sites, project management settingsShip engines, propulsion systems, onboard or repair facilities, manufacturing plants
Industry UsageShip design, construction, and project management within maritime industryOperation, maintenance, and repair of marine propulsion and mechanical systems

While both roles require engineering backgrounds and work within the maritime industry, Project Engineer Naval Architects focus on ship design and project management, whereas Marine Engineers specialize in the operation and maintenance of marine propulsion systems.

A DAY IN THE LIFE OF A CIVIL PROJECT MANAGER
As a Civil Project Manager, you play an integral part in ensuring that clients receive quality outcomes from our land development projects. You do more than just manage project scope, schedule, and budget. The "face" of CEI, you are involved in the conceptual and design phases, the review process, bidding, construction, and project completion. You pride yourself on your ability to develop repeat business based on quality work and excellent service.
Highly collaborative, you are a key point of contact for clients, contractors, and local government officials. You coordinate work with staff and design team members. In every land development project, there are design aspects that you review. These may include site landscape layouts, grading plans, stormwater management facilities, water quality practices, or utilities. With attention to detail, you also review work products, quality control, and budgeting. You get great satisfaction from leading your team to complete important projects successfully, which is why you're perfect for this project management position!
QUALIFICATIONS FOR A CIVIL PROJECT MANAGER
  • Bachelor's degree in civil engineering, landscape architecture, or equivalent training/experience
  • 3+ years of experience in land/site development with experience in utilities, drainage, quality control, site entitlement, and progressive project management
  • Working knowledge of AutoCAD, Civil 3D, and Microsoft Office Suite
  • Valid driver's license, an acceptable driving record, and the ability to occasionally travel overnight
  • A professional engineer (PE) license is preferred but not required.
